Hiring a Privacy Screening Landscaping Contractor in Dayton, OH

When comparing privacy screening landscaping contractors in Dayton, ask each company to quote the same scope, material grade, permit responsibility, cleanup, warranty, and timeline. That keeps the $1,390 to $18,534 local range useful instead of comparing unrelated bids.

Bid must include

Labor hours, material allowance, permit responsibility, disposal, equipment rental, and any change-order rules.

Verify before deposit

License status, insurance, recent local photos, warranty term, payment schedule, and who handles inspections.

Red flags

Cash-only pricing, vague scope, no written warranty, unusually low pump or material allowance, or a large upfront payment.

Methodology & Local Data Sources

How we estimate privacy screening landscaping costs in Dayton: Our local cost figure of $5,560 for Dayton, OH is calculated by adjusting the national mid-range baseline of $6,000 using two location-specific factors:

  1. Labor adjustment55%% of the project cost is labor. We multiply this by Dayton's wage index, derived from B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ics for construction workers (SOC 47-0000). Dayton skilled-trade labor averages $28.21/hr, compared to the national construction worker median.
  2. Materials adjustment45%% of cost is materials. Dayton's material cost index is 91 (national baseline = 100), based on regional shipping, lumber, concrete, and metal prices tracked by the Bureau of Labor Statistics Producer Price Index for Construction Materials.
  3. Permit fees add $962 on average in Dayton. Permit costs vary by project scope, square footage (200 sqft typical), and inspection requirements set by the local building department.
  4. Scope pricing for this project in Dayton: quotes should be compared by equipment, design, access, permit, and finish assumptions rather than a square-foot shortcut.
